By Tim Glon
ADA — Freshman Keaghan Burden (Brunswick) had a goal and a career-high six assists to lead the Ohio Northern women's lacrosse team in a 15-10 setback against Otterbein on Wednesday night at Dial-Roberson Stadium.
The Polar Bears fall to 5-6 overall and are 1-2 in the Ohio Athletic Conference, while the Cardinals improve to 5-5, 3-1.
Sophomores Sydney Kilgore (Pleasant Plain/Little Miami) and Elizabeth Graham (Riverside/Carroll) each had three goal hat tricks, with all three of Kilgore's goals coming off Burden assists.
OU led 5-1 after the first period, but Burden assisted on three straight tallies as the Polar Bears scored three goals in 1:58 to pull within 5-4 midway through the second quarter.
The lead was 11-9 when the Cardinals scored four straight, holding ONU scoreless for nearly 10 minutes, to extend the lead to 15-9 with 8:07 left to play.
The two teams each had 26 shots and ONU won the ground ball battle 22-14, but the guests had 11 saves in goal to just three for the hosts.
